October 22nd 2010 Your Aberdeen Wings welcomed the Alexandria Blizzard (Now Brookings) to the Odde Ice Center for the first game of a home and home weekend.  The Wings jumped on top early and often getting goals from Max Reavis (2), Nils Semjonovos, Tyler Poulsen and Cory Ward through the first 2 periods to take a 5-0 lead into the 3rd.  The Blizzard were able to get 2 goals midway through the final period to make things a little interesting but ultimately Wings Goaltender Hunter Leisner would shut the door making 42 saves on 45 shots.

The following night the Wings would hit the road and allow Alexandria to play host.  The Wings were to pack the momentum on the bus and take is to the Blizzard once again.  Christian McCollum would get the Wings on the board and Tim Tuscher, Paul Prescott & Cody Marooney would follow his lead to take a 4-0 lead.  Alex would get a goal midway through the 2nd but the Wings responded in the 3rd with goals from Tyler Poulsen and Cory Ward.  Late in the 3rd the Blizzard would add another but it was to late for a comeback as once again Leisner stood tall stopping 53 of the 55 shots he faced giving the Wings the weekend sweep of the Blizzard!
